Middle Dot

ASCII byte 183 (0xB7) — Unicode U+00B7. Standard ASCII is 0–127; extended bytes 128–255 use Windows-1252.

Linux

  1. Copy · with the Copy Symbol button and paste it.
  2. Press Ctrl + Shift + U, type 00b7 (from U+00B7), then press Enter or Space.
  3. On GNOME, you can also use Ctrl + . (or Ctrl + ;) to open the character picker.
  4. In HTML, use ·.
